Cognism vs Apollo.io Pricing Comparison
| Feature/Brand | Cognism | Apollo.io |
|---|---|---|
| Free Trial | No free trial available. | Yes, provides a 7-day free trial. |
| Pricing Tiers | – Essentials – Professional – Business – Enterprise |
– Free – Basic – Professional – Enterprise |
| Monthly/Annual Pricing | – Essentials: $249/user/month – Professional: $399/user/month – Business: $599/user/month – Enterprise: Custom pricing |
– Free: $0 – Basic: $29/user/month billed annually ($39 if monthly) – Professional: $59/user/month billed annually ($79 if monthly) – Enterprise: Custom pricing |
| Main Offerings | – Essentials: Basic lead generation & data enrichment – Professional: Enhanced features including advanced search & integrations – Business: Advanced analytics, team collaboration tools – Enterprise: Comprehensive solutions with dedicated support |
– Free: Limited access to features – Basic: Basic lead generation, CRM integration – Professional: Advanced features, enriched datasets, better support – Enterprise: Full platform access, custom solutions, and API access |
| Data Sources | Proprietary database & compliance assurance. | Extensive database with integrations; limited on Free tier. |
| Support | Email support for Essentials, priority support for higher tiers. | Community support for Free, email & chat support for paid tiers. |
| Additional Features | GDPR compliance, API access in higher tiers. | Advanced filters, engagement tracking in Professional and Enterprise tiers. |
| Discounts | Annual commitment may provide discounted rates; inquire for specific offers. | Significant savings on annual plans versus monthly subscriptions. |
Summary of Key Differences:
- Cognism does not offer a free trial, while Apollo.io allows users to test their features with a 7-day free trial.
- Cognism’s pricing starts higher than Apollo.io’s options; however, Cognism’s advanced capabilities might be better suited for businesses seeking compliance and lead quality assurance.
- Apollo.io presents a tiered pricing structure that allows entry-level users to access basic features for free, which can be preferable for startups.
